Recurring Saturday Night Live characters and sketches introduced 2000–2001

Index Recurring Saturday Night Live characters and sketches introduced 2000–2001

The following is a list of recurring Saturday Night Live characters and sketches introduced between October 7, 2000, and May 19, 2001, the twenty-sixth season of SNL. [1]
